Each individual is composed of one or more minimal living units, called cells, and is capable of transformation of compounds, growth, and participation in reproductive acts. Life is matter that has biological processes, such as signaling and the ability to sustain itself. It is defined descriptively by the capacity for homeostasis, organisation, metabolism, growth, adaptation, response to stimuli, and reproduction. Life: Defining Life The basic constituents of life are also the most common elements in the universe: carbon, oxygen, hydrogen, nitrogen. Many biochemists therefore regard the emergence of life as inevitable wherever the right chemical and environmental conditions exist.
